Welcome to follow the doctoral defense of Kaisa Kraft on Friday 20th September at 13.15 (EET).
The opponent is Michael Brosnahan from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ution. The title of the dissertation is High-throughput imaging of the Baltic Sea phytoplankton community with an emphasis on bloom-forming cyanobacteria. The online dissertation can be accessed here 10 days prior to the defense.The thesis deals with suitability and comparability of the automated imaging for Baltic Sea phytoplankton, and applied machine learning (CNN) for the automated identification of the taxa, useful methods for both research and monitoring purposes.
